School Climate and Social and Emotional Learning

School climate and social and emotional learning is an article based on school climate. "School climate" is cleaning up school violence and making the school community secure and safe for everyone to learn better in a better enviroment.The article points out 4 main ways of providing a better enviroment for students to learn in. Safety, Teaching an Learning, Interpersonal Relationship, and Institutional Enviromental. The National school climate council, education commissiom of the states, and the center for emotional and social education say's that social climate lays under many dimensions as I mention earlier: social climate is all about"the quality and character of school life", and "school climate is based on patterns of students, parents, and school personel"
